Strange and Wonderful Animals Explored

March 5, 2017 in Amazing FactsBiomimeticsBirdsCell BiologyGeneticsHuman BodyIntelligent DesignMammalsMarine BiologyMind and BrainPhysicsTerrestrial Zoology

Look at what scientists are learning about some common animals, and others not so common.

Read Full Article >

Mental Miracles You Don’t Know About

October 18, 2016 in Amazing FactsBible and TheologyCell BiologyEducationHealthHuman BodyIntelligent DesignMammalsMind and BrainPhilosophy of Science

Your brain and eyes do things that scientists didn’t discover till recently.

Read Full Article >

Humans: More than Dust in the Cosmic Wind

March 12, 2016 in Amazing FactsBible and TheologyHealthHuman BodyIntelligent DesignMind and BrainOrigin of LifePhilosophy of Science

Superb design in the human body counters the claim we are mere starstuff.

Read Full Article >

Invisible Subs and Other Tricks Inspired by Life

November 21, 2015 in Amazing FactsBiomimeticsBirdsBotanyCell BiologyIntelligent DesignMarine BiologyPhilosophy of SciencePhysicsTerrestrial Zoology

Working scientists seem less focused on evolution and more on design these days, figuring out how animals and plants do amazing things.

Read Full Article >

Creatures Worth Knowing and Imitating

July 21, 2015 in Amazing FactsBiomimeticsBirdsCell BiologyIntelligent DesignMarine BiologyPhysicsTerrestrial Zoology

Studies of animals and cells reveal designs in nature we can appreciate and imitate.

Read Full Article >

Save Your Eyes: Take a Hike

March 21, 2015 in HealthHuman Body

An epidemic of myopia is swamping Asian health care institutions. The cause could depend on what side of the front door you tend to be.

Read Full Article >

Mantis Shrimp Baffles Evolutionists

July 6, 2014 in Amazing FactsDarwin and EvolutionIntelligent DesignMarine BiologyPhysics

Stomatopods, popularly known as mantis shrimp, possess several unique abilities that defy evolution.

Read Full Article >

Archive Classic: Evolution Goes Forward, Backward and Sideways

June 15, 2014 in Darwin and EvolutionDumb IdeasPhilosophy of Science

This is a reprint from 12/19/07. It is still worth thinking about.

Read Full Article >